About the Item

Timeless and iconic, Wedgwood’s Jasperware trinket boxes are miniature works of art that blend classical beauty with everyday function. First developed in the 18th century by Josiah Wedgwood, Jasperware is celebrated for its distinctive matte finish and contrasting reliefs in soft white, often depicting scenes from mythology or neoclassical motifs. Each box carries the heritage of Wedgwood’s craftsmanship—elegant yet durable stoneware that feels both ornamental and practical. Perfect for holding keepsakes, jewelry, or simply admired as a collectible, Jasperware trinket boxes remain unique for their instantly recognizable style: a delicate harmony of colour, history, and artistry.
